Tech’s hottest role isn’t coding—it's storytelling, with salaries up to $775K

TL;DR Summary
Amid the AI boom, tech firms are hiring more comms pros—storytellers, editors, and chief communications officers—at high pay to shape credible narratives; roles like Netflix’s director of product and technology communications can reach up to $775,000, while the median pay for senior comms leaders hovers around $400,000–$450,000, signaling a shift from pure coding to high-value storytelling in tech hiring.
